Features and Benefits of DLP TVs

Even today, Texas Instruments remains the primary manufacturer of this technology. Many different manufacturers license the technology from Texas Instruments, and build their products around the TI chipset. In addition to its use in televisions and projectors, DLP technology is used in a number of specialized applications such as lithography and imaging.


DLP technology differs from other video technology in that it utilizes a small digital micromirror device (DMD) to tilt more than 1.3 million of these tiny mirrors, each of them smaller than the width of a human hair either toward or away from the light source contained within the DLP device. The Three Faces of LCD TV

Let s clear up a couple of misconceptions about HDTV (High Definition Television) as it applies to the rapidly emerging LCD technologies. The acronym LCD stands for Liquid Crystal Display. Occasionally, you will run across someone who defines it as Liquid Crystal Diode. This is incorrect. They are most certainly confusing LCD with LED. LED stands for Light Emitting Diode, and is perhaps best known as the red lights that we have seen on clock radios for years. (today, LED s are able to produce many other cool colors.) Types of Monitors

A cathode ray tube or CRT, is traditionally used in most computer monitors and the advent of plasma screens, LCD , DLP, OLED displays, and other technologies. As a result of CRT technology, computer monitors continue to be referred to as “The Tube”.A CRT works by moving an electron beam back and forth across the back of the screen. Each time the beam makes a pass across the screen, it lights up phosphor dots on the inside of the glass tube, thereby illuminating the active portions of the screen. By drawing many such lines from the top to the bottom of the screen, it creates an entire screenful of images.
